Currently teaching music at Fletcher's Meadows Secondary School in Brampton, Ontario, Paul Llew-Williams has taught music for 15 years in the Peel District School Board. Nine of those years have been in instrumental and general music at the middle school level, and another six at the high school level. Paul has been composing for thirty years in many different styles, and is also performing regularly with a Latin/ Jazz trio. He has written music for choirs, concert band, guitar ensembles, and has even written a full blown musical called TRace. He earned his degree at The University of Western Ontario in Music/ Arts, and went onto earn his Bachelor of Education degree at the University of Windsor. Paul's varied musical experiences and understanding of the emerging band student, makes his music approachable, and lends a variety to your band repertoire.
